Heavy machinery skates are specialized devices designed to facilitate the movement of large, heavy equipment. Made from durable materials, these skates are equipped with metal or rubber wheels that allow for smooth movement over various surfaces. They come in varying sizes and load capacities, catering to different types of machinery. The versatility of heavy machinery skates makes them invaluable in workplaces where heavy equipment needs to be relocated regularly.
One of the primary benefits of using heavy machinery skates is that they significantly reduce the risk of injury during the moving process. Traditional methods, such as using ropes or manual labor to pull heavy machinery, can lead to accidents, including strains, sprains, or worse injuries for workers. By employing skates, the weight is distributed evenly, reducing the strain on individuals and minimizing the likelihood of accidents. This enhances workplace safety, ensuring that employees can perform their tasks without jeopardizing their well-being.
Another advantage of heavy machinery skates is their ability to save time and increase efficiency. Moving heavy equipment can be a time-consuming task, often requiring the coordination of multiple personnel and equipment. With skates, a single operator can maneuver the equipment with greater ease and speed. This efficiency not only expedites project timelines but also leads to significant labor cost savings. As businesses strive to optimize their operations, investing in high-quality skates becomes a logical and worthwhile decision.
Moreover, heavy machinery skates are designed to provide stability during movement. Unlike other makeshift solutions that can lead to tipping or shifting of weight, skates maintain a lower center of gravity, ensuring that the machinery remains steady. This stability is paramount when navigating uneven surfaces or tight spaces, which is often the case in construction sites or warehouses. Using skates minimizes the potential for mishaps, such as dropping equipment, which can lead to costly damage or downtime.
